获取与列表项相关的解析对象的目标

时间:2016-01-18 12:37:44

标签: android listview parse-platform

我有一个列表视图,可以从parse.com检索数据。我添加了一个onitemlongclicllstener来删除从列表中长按的列表项,甚至是从解析数据库中删除的列表项。我知道如何从列表中删除,但不知道如何从解析数据库。 每个listitem都有一个与之相关的唯一对象ID。 如果我们想从解析数据库中删除,那么我们就是根据解析文档

进行的
ParseObject.createWithoutData("invFriend", "efgh").deleteEventually();

我的朋友是类名,efgh是与要删除的列表项相关的对象ID

如果我们知道对象id

,这是有效的

但是,如果我们不知道用户长按的列表项的对象ID,该怎么办? 如何传入对象id参数

1 个答案:

答案 0 :(得分:0)

您可以找到每个列表项的对象ID,如下所示

channelList.get(i).getObjectId()

其中channelList是解析对象列表。